Series 114 DPDT Non-Latching Established Reliability / Military Relay CENTIGRID(R) ESTABLISHED RELIABILITY MILITARY DPDT SERIES RELAY TYPE 114 DPDT basic relay 114D DPDT relay with internal diode for coil transient suppression 114DD DPDT relay with internal diodes for coil transient suppression and polarity reversal protection DESCRIPTION The 114 sensitive Centigrid(R) relay retains the same features as the 114 standard Centigrid(R) relay with only a minimal increase in profile height (.275 in.). Its .100-inch grid spaced terminals, which preclude the need for spreader pads, and its low profile make the 134 relay ideal for applications where high packaging density is important. The following unique construction features and manufacturing techniques provide excellent resistance to environmental extremes and overall high reliability: The 114 feature: * All welded construction. * Advanced cleaning techniques provide maximum assurance of internal cleanliness. * Unique uni-frame design providing high magnetic efficiency and mechanical rigidity. (c) 2018 TELEDYNE RELAYS * High force/mass ratios for resistance to shock and vibration. * Precious metal alloy contact material with gold plating assures excellent high current and dry circuit switching capabilities. The Series 114D and 114DD have internal discrete silicon diodes for coil suppression and polarity reversal protection. By virtue of its inherently low intercontact capacitance and contact circuit losses, the 114 relay has proven to be an excellent ultraminiature RF switch for frequency ranges well into the UHF spectrum.
